About The Position

T he experimental nuclear physics group working in medium energy and fundamental symmetries at t he Un i vers it y of T ennessee i s seek i ng cand i da t es for a pos t doc t oral p o s iti on to begin in January 2026 . The successful candidate will have a role in the group’s neutron beta decay efforts at Oak Ridge National Lab as well as ongoing analysis work of Jefferson Lab (JLab) experiments and work towards future ones. T he cand i da t e m ust have a P h D (or sa ti sf i ed a l l subs t an ti ve requ i re m en t s for a P hD) i n nuc l ear or particle ph y s i cs. The successful candidate contributes to the running of the Nab beta decay experiment at ORNL and data analysis. Additionally, the successful candidate will help bring online a Dynamic Nuclear Polarization system and assist with data analysis of JLab experiments. Finally, the successful candidate will be expected to assist with supervision of graduate and undergraduate students as well as work in a multi-institutional collaboration. T he appo i n tm e n t w il l be i n iti a ll y for one year, w it h poss i b l e renewal for t wo add iti on a l years upon m u t ual agree m ent and ava il ab i lit y of funds.

Requirements

  • PhD in physics by Dec 2025
  • Working in large experimental collaborations
  • Data analysis of large data sets.
  • Experience with vacuum and cryogenic apparatus.

Nice To Haves

  • Working at a large user facility
  • python
  • root/C++
  • Labview
  • Class IV laser operation
  • laser optics alignment.

Responsibilities

  • Take a leading role in Nab beta decay experiment at the Spallation Neutron Source.
  • Coordinate some fraction of those efforts, interfacing with collaborators at other institutions and staff scientists at ORNL.
  • Design and construction of apparatus, taking data with neutrons, analysis said data and presenting it to the collaboration and the community at large at scientific conferences.
  • Mentor and supervise graduate and undergraduate students.
  • Work with graduate students and ORNL and JLab collaborators to commission and upgrade a Dynamic Nuclear Physics apparatus at UT.
  • Analyze data from JLab experiments and present it to the nuclear physics community.
